The Solaris CIFS service is only
supported on the Solaris Express
and OpenSolaris OSes. It is not
available with the Solaris 10 OS.
Solaris CIFS and Samba are mutually
exclusive services where only one
service can be running at a time.
You will need to install the Solaris CIFS
service packages on your Solaris
Express or OpenSolaris system. See
